Ottawa Police advises all vehicle owners to 'lock their doors'
News Posted by OttawaStart on August 03, 2012
The Ottawa Police Service reminds vehicle owners that the best way to avoid thefts is through crime prevention.
Since June 1, 2012, police have received 313 complaints of thefts from vehicles in the areas of Barrhaven, Morgan’s Grant, Carlington, Leslie Park, Britannia, Stittsville, Glen Cairn, Bridlewood and Westboro.
“Four adults and three youths have been charged with theft from vehicles in the west end, but that doesn’t account for all reported incidents,” said Mike Rice, Inspector of West District Investigations. “These thefts are crimes of opportunity. In most cases, police found that owners failed to lock their vehicles.”
To make your vehicle more secure and less likely to be targeted, follow these three easy crime prevention tips:
- Always close your windows and lock all doors.
- Remove all valuables from your vehicle and if not possible, remove from view.
- Report crime in your neighbourhood. Call police immediately at 613-230-6211 if you see any suspicious persons or activity.
